Footwear..what's your choice?
Like a lot of people, I like to ride my bike to work. What I don't like is wearing my boots if I'm stuck in an office all day. I also don't like wearing boots when it's hot out. 99% of the time, I just wear my sneakers when riding.
Question is, what do you wear and why?

Boots 99% of the time, but I took the bike around the block in sneakers last week after putting slip-ons on it. Country roads, no traffic. That accounts for my 1%. The first thing I noticed was I had more traction when stopped than my usual riding boots gave me, which are cowboy style, work boots, so I ordered a pair of "real" riding boots after letting Google work for me. I love these boots. and for seventy bucks..... can't be beat.
